Details
A vulnerability, which was classified as critical, was found in Firebase util up to 0.3.3. This affects the function deepExtend of the file DeepCopy.ts. The manipulation with an unknown input leads to a code injection vulnerability. CWE is classifying the issue as CWE-94. The product constructs all or part of a code segment using externally-influenced input from an upstream component, but it does not neutralize or incorrectly neutralizes special elements that could modify the syntax or behavior of the intended code segment. This is going to have an impact on confidentiality, integrity, and availability.
The weakness was presented 11/16/2020 as SNYK-JS-FIREBASEUTIL-1038324. The advisory is shared at snyk.io. This vulnerability is uniquely identified as CVE-2020-7765. Technical details are known, but no exploit is available. MITRE ATT&CK project uses the attack technique T1059 for this issue.
Upgrading to version 0.3.4 eliminates this vulnerability. Applying a patch is able to eliminate this problem. The bugfix is ready for download at github.com. The best possible mitigation is suggested to be upgrading to the latest version.
